Urban areas often experience higher temperatures than surrounding rural areas, a phenomenon known as the Urban Heat Island (UHI) effect. This can lead to increased energy consumption, health issues, and environmental challenges. One effective strategy to combat UHI is the use of Built-Up Roofing (BUR) systems, which can help reduce heat absorption and improve urban climate conditions.
Understanding the Urban Heat Island Effect
The UHI effect occurs when city surfaces like asphalt, concrete, and dark roofing materials absorb and retain heat during the day, releasing it slowly at night. This results in elevated temperatures in urban environments, often several degrees higher than rural areas. The heat can increase cooling costs and exacerbate health problems, especially during heatwaves.
What is BUR Roofing?
Built-Up Roofing (BUR) is a traditional roofing system composed of multiple layers of bitumen (asphalt or coal tar) and reinforcing fabrics. It is covered with a protective surface, which can be gravel, mineral granules, or reflective coatings. BUR roofs are known for their durability, weather resistance, and versatility.
How BUR Roofing Helps Reduce UHI
Modern BUR systems can be enhanced with reflective coatings that significantly lower surface temperatures. These reflective or cool roof coatings reflect more sunlight and absorb less heat, helping to keep building surfaces cooler. This reduction in heat absorption decreases the overall heat released into the urban environment, mitigating the UHI effect.
Advantages of Using Reflective BUR Systems
- Lower Surface Temperatures: Reflective coatings reduce the heat absorbed by roofs.
- Energy Efficiency: Cooler roofs decrease the need for air conditioning, saving energy.
- Extended Roof Lifespan: Reduced thermal stress can prolong roof durability.
- Environmental Benefits: Less heat released into the environment helps cool urban areas.
Implementation and Considerations
To maximize the benefits of BUR roofing in reducing UHI, building owners should consider reflective coatings and proper insulation. It’s important to select coatings with high solar reflectance and durability. Regular maintenance ensures the reflective properties are maintained over time, providing ongoing benefits.
